| 28th December - Ring of Kerry Tour |
|
| There is an unspoilt nature to Ireland's most beautiful region and the Ring of Kerry provides many unforgettable sights and sounds. An essential part of any visit to Ireland, this tour circles |
|
 |
|
| the magnificent MacGillycuddy Reeks - runs through its many passes and valleys along the shore of Dingle Bay and Kenmare Bay. You will visit the many picturesque villages such as Glenbeigh, Waterville and Sneem. Return via Ladies View, the famous Lakes of Killarney and through the Oakwoods of Killarney's magnificent National Park. The tour leaves Killarney at 10:30 am and returns at 5.00 pm that evening. |
